BFS patch for 2.6.35 (git linus kernel)

Con Kolivas mantains a great patch for the linux kernel (check it out: http://ck.kolivas.org/patches/bfs/)

However he can't port the patch every while to the latest kernel, so he often waits for stable releases.

Since I really need to use 2.6.35 and don't want to miss BFS, I have ported his patch to 2.6.35, here is the result:

http://www.iragan.com/linux/unofficial-BFS/

Please notice that this is not guaranteed to work, although I am using it right now without any glitch.

Re: BFS patch for 2.6.35 (git linus kernel)

BFS patch doesn't work anymore on latest kernel (it has been some week now); I suppose there is some new subsystem which needs an adapted counterpart in the BFS patch.

The system stucks some time during D-BUS initialization and the hangup is basically due to timers never releasing (some preemption issue?)

Edit: Con Kolivas has provided a patch for 2.6.35 on 7 August, check it out. However it doesn't work because misses the fixes for slow-work.c and oom_kill.c
